dog pulls elderly woman down and attacks another dog at parkHinsdale IL

audio iconOther Crimes
Burns Field Park, Burns Field Park, 320 N Vine St, Hinsdale, IL 60521

An elderly woman walking a tan pit bull at Burns Field was pulled down by the dog. The dog then attacked another dog. The caller declined contact and requested animal control be notified.
